Energy ESO Market Research, 2032

The global energy ESO market was valued at $183.1 billion in 2022, and is projected to reach $522.5 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 11.2% from 2023 to 2032.

Energy ESO Market

Energy engineering offerings outsourcing (ESO) refers to the strategic exercise of entrusting specialized energy engineering tasks and duties to external carrier carriers or organizations. These duties can encompass a vast spectrum of activities, consisting of electricity audits, diagrams and implementation of energy-efficient systems, renewable strength integration, and electricity management services. ESO is rooted in the notion of optimizing energy-related processes, decreasing costs, and improving sustainability by leveraging the understanding and sources of third-party gurus or firms.

Energy ESO industry is important in the industrial sector, where they are deeply engaged in enhancing strength effectivity and usage optimization. Manufacturing plants, factories, and industrial services use a great amount of power to energy their machinery and operations. ESO carriers work carefully with these industries, conducting energy audits to pinpoint areas of inefficiency and suggesting strategies for improvement. These enhancements can encompass upgrading equipment, integrating energy-efficient technologies, or transitioning to renewable energy sources such as solar or wind power. ESO services contribute to value discounts and environmental sustainability in the industrial sector.

The commercial construction area is another area where ESO performs a crucial role. Property proprietors and facility managers turn to ESO for energy-efficient building graph and retrofitting services. This can include the installation of advanced he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, smart lighting fixtures solutions, and power administration systems. Outsourcing services for business buildings can lead to significant power savings, better indoor comfort, and alignment with rigorous energy regulations.

ESO has expanded its presence in the renewable energy quarter by providing comprehensive services for the integration and tremendous administration of renewable strength systems. These services encompass the whole lot from the planning and setup of solar panels, wind turbines, and power storage solutions. ESO's crew of professionals assists individuals, businesses, and nearby governments in using renewable strength sources to minimize their dependency on fossil fuels and address environmental issues effectively.

The rise in demand for digitization drives the energy ESO market growth during the forecast period.

The area of energy engineering services is experiencing a full-size transformation driven by means of increase in demand for digitization. A key element of this transformation is the adoption of digital twin technology. Digital twins are virtual replicas of physical assets, such as energy flowers or renewable electricity facilities, enabling real-time monitoring, simulation, and facts analysis. Capgemini, in collaboration with Microsoft, introduced ReflectIoD, a serverless, cloud-native digital twin platform in October 2022. This platform enhances operational and maintenance efficiency, fostering wise industries and economic value generation.

The Internet of Things (IoT) performs an essential position in digitalization by deploying units throughout energy infrastructure to acquire real-time data. Qualcomm introduced superior IoT options in April 2023, helping various IoT applications in smart buildings, enterprises, retail, and industrial automation. The rise in demand for digitization is expected to drive the power engineering offerings outsourcing market growth as it allows predictive maintenance, performance optimization, and data-driven decision-making in the energy sector.

Historic Trends:

  • The concept of outsourcing energy engineering offerings began to gain traction in the early 2000s as organizations started out looking for methods to limit operational expenses and enhance energy efficiency.
  • In 2005, ESO commenced to gain greater prominence as a low-cost solution for businesses to control their energy-related operations. Companies started out to explore outsourcing selections for duties such as strength auditing and information analysis.
  • In 2010, ESO services continued to expand, encompassing a broader variety of energy-related activities. This protected offerings related to renewable electricity projects, electricity management systems, and sustainability consulting.
  • In 2015, the importance of ESO grew to be even more substantial with the growing emphasis on sustainability and environmental responsibility. Many corporations turned to outsourcing to meet their renewable strength dreams and decrease their carbon footprint.
  • In 2020, the energy enterprise witnessed significant changes in this year, partly driven by way of the COVID-19 pandemic. ESO providers tailored to far-off working and digital solutions to continue supporting their clients' power needs.
  • In 2021, ESO offerings expanded to include superior applied sciences such as synthetic brain (AI) and machine learning (ML) for predictive maintenance and energy optimization. The focus shifted towards data-driven decision-making.
  • In 2022, the global transition to cleaner energy sources and increase in demand for energy effectivity options led to a surge in ESO demand. Companies appeared for specialized outsourcing companions to navigate the changing energy landscape.

The high cost of energy engineering solutions is expected to hinder the growth of the energy ESO market. Energy engineering solutions frequently need significant upfront investments to be implemented. This can deter some businesses, especially smaller ones, from adopting energy-efficient technologies. Incentives such as grants, rebates, and cash incentives are frequently provided by governments and utility companies to entice firms to invest in energy-efficient technologies. These incentives can greatly reduce the upfront costs and increase the attractiveness of such investments.
